As of July 4, 2026, the median asking price for houses in
Long Branch, Etobicoke is $1,318,000.
Compared with the other neighbourhoods in Etobicoke:
Higher-priced than Long Branch, Etobicoke:
Edenbridge-Humber Valley ($3,899,000, about 195.8% higher), Princess-Rosethorn ($2,399,999, about 82.1% higher), Kingsway South ($2,319,000, about 75.9% higher), Islington-City Centre West ($2,075,000, about 57.4% higher), Stonegate-Queensway ($1,998,950, about 51.7% higher), Mimico ($1,695,000, about 28.6% higher), Markland Wood ($1,563,500, about 18.6% higher), Humber Heights ($1,479,000, about 12.2% higher), Willowridge-Martingrove-Richview ($1,425,888, about 8.2% higher), Alderwood ($1,369,444, about 3.9% higher), Eringate-Centennial-West Deane ($1,322,450, about 0.3% higher), and Kingsview Village-The Westway ($1,319,000, about 0.1% higher).
Lower-priced than Long Branch, Etobicoke:
New Toronto ($1,299,000, about 1.4% lower), Etobicoke West Mall ($1,159,900, about 12% lower), Thistletown-Beaumonde Heights ($962,000, about 27% lower), Mount Olive-Silverstone-Jamestown ($944,000, about 28.4% lower), West Humber-Clairville ($928,900, about 29.5% lower), Elms-Old Rexdale ($884,450, about 32.9% lower), and Rexdale-Kipling ($883,944, about 32.9% lower).
